load_lib "trace-support.exp"


gdb_exit
gdb_start
standard_testfile actions.c
if { [gdb_compile "$srcdir/$subdir/$srcfile" $binfile \
	  executable {debug nowarnings}] != "" } {
    untested "failed to compile"
    return -1
}
gdb_load $binfile

# PR gdb/21352: Command tsave does not support -r argument
gdb_test "tsave -r" "Argument required \\\(file in which to save trace data\\\)\." \
    "tsave command properly supports -r argument"

gdb_test "tvariable \$tvar1" \
  "Trace state variable \\\$tvar1 created, with initial value 0." \
  "create a trace state variable"

gdb_test "tvariable \$tvar2 = 45" \
  "Trace state variable \\\$tvar2 created, with initial value 45." \
  "create a trace state variable with initial value"

gdb_test "tvariable \$tvar2 = -92" \
  "Trace state variable \\\$tvar2 now has initial value -92." \
  "change initial value of a trace state variable"

gdb_test "tvariable \$tvar3 = 2 + 3" \
  "Trace state variable \\\$tvar3 created, with initial value 5." \
  "create a trace state variable with expression"

gdb_test "tvariable \$tvar3 = 1234567000000" \
  "Trace state variable \\\$tvar3 now has initial value 1234567000000." \
  "init trace state variable to a 64-bit value"

gdb_test "tvariable $" \
  "Must supply a non-empty variable name" \
  "tvariable syntax error, not empty variable name"

gdb_test "tvariable main" \
  "Name of trace variable should start with '\\\$'" \
  "tvariable syntax error, bad name"

gdb_test "tvariable \$\$" \
  "Syntax must be \\\$NAME \\\[ = EXPR \\\]" \
  "tvariable syntax error, bad name 2"

gdb_test "tvariable \$123" \
  "\\\$123 is not a valid trace state variable name" \
  "tvariable syntax error, bad name 3"

gdb_test "tvariable \$tvar1 - 93" \
  "Syntax must be \\\$NAME \\\[ = EXPR \\\]" \
  "tvariable syntax error, not an assignment"

gdb_test "tvariable \$tvar0 = 1 = 1" \
  "Left operand of assignment is not an lvalue\." \
  "tvariable creation fails with invalid expression"

gdb_test "info tvariables" \
    "Name\[\t \]+Initial\[\t \]+Current.*
\\\$tvar1\[\t \]+0\[\t \]+<undefined>.*
\\\$tvar2\[\t \]+-92\[\t \]+<undefined>.*
\\\$tvar3\[\t \]+1234567000000\[\t \]+.*<undefined>.*" \
  "List tvariables"

gdb_test "print \$tvar2" " = void" \
    "Print a trace state variable before run"

gdb_test_no_output "delete tvariable \$tvar2" \
  "delete trace state variable"

gdb_test "info tvariables" \
    "Name\[\t \]+Initial\[\t \]+Current.*
\\\$tvar1\[\t \]+0\[\t \]+<undefined>.*
\\\$tvar3\[\t \]+1234567000000\[\t \]+.*<undefined>.*" \
  "List tvariables after deletion"

gdb_test "delete tvariable" \
    "" \
    "Delete all trace state variables" \
    "Delete all trace state variables.*y or n.*$" \
    "y"

gdb_test "info tvariables" \
  "No trace state variables.*" \
  "list tvariables after deleting all"
